Bournemouth Buccaneers suffered their second league defeat of the season as Plymouth Devils gained some revenge over the Buccaneers who earlier had dumped them out of the K.O.Cup. With Bournemouth missing their influential 'J-H Bomb' factor over Jay Herne and Jerran Hart, both of whom had Premier league engagements they couldn't get out of the Devils rocked the Buccaneers from the very off with two 5-1 heat advantages in the first four races. Indeed the Buccaneers had to wait until heat 12 before they could boast a race winner and that came from the highly impressive Kyle Newman who was wearing the black and white colour which meant his three points were doubled to six and with Aaron Baseby making a telling first lap pass finishing second the visitors netted a massive 8-1 to make a big dent in the 14 point deficit halving it to just 7. That left them with some hope that they could still come away from the Saint Boniface Arena with something for their efforts if they could gain another heat advantage, although with Seemond Stephens and Kyle Hughes both likely contenders for a heat 15 outing as at that stage they were both unbeaten it appeared a monumental task A heat gain looked most unlikely in heat 14 when Jon Resch appeared harshly treated with a disqualification when he moved upsides of David Gough on the second lap. But in a bizarre twist to the re-run leader Seemond Stephens locked up and fell allowing Aaron Baseby to take the flag ahead of the only other finisher Gough for a 3-2 advantage to the Buccaneers.
